I wanted to gain a better understanding of what my Cook & King families experienced in the region where they lived during the Civil War. They resided in the southern part of Rutherford County and northern Bedford County, Tennessee. I made a list of key locations and notable events from those areas using Long's Civil War Day by Day. The first part of 1863 appears to have been a particularly difficult time for them. I plan to do this exercise for a few other families and regions.
